About the MenACWY vaccine
The MenACWY vaccine helps protect against life-threatening illnesses including meningitis, sepsis and septicaemia (blood poisoning).
It is recommended for all teenagers. Most people only need 1 dose of the vaccine.

About the Td/IPV vaccine
The Td/IPV vaccine (3-in-1 teenage booster) helps protect against tetanus, diphtheria and polio.
It’s offered at around 13 or 14 years old (school year 9 or 10). It boosts the protection provided by the 6-in-1 vaccine and 4-in-1 pre-school booster vaccine.

Talk to your child about what they want
We suggest you talk to your child about the vaccinations before you respond to us.
Young people have the right to refuse vaccinations. Those who show ‘Gillick competence’ have the right to consent to vaccinations themselves. Our team may assess Gillick competence during vaccination sessions.
